What is uPVC?
uPVC, or unplasticized polyvinyl chloride, is a rigid kind of PVC that is devoid of plasticizers, making it highly resilient and long-lasting. Unlike wood, metal, or other standard materials, uPVC is resistant to wetness, weather condition, and deterioration, making it a perfect choice for both domestic and business properties.

Benefits of uPVC Windows and Doors
1. Energy Efficiency
Among the standout features of uPVC windows and doors is their remarkable insulation properties. They are developed to reduce heat loss, assisting to keep your home warm in winter season and cool in summer. The multi-chambered frames of uPVC doors and windows create a thermal barrier, while double or triple-glazing choices even more enhance energy effectiveness. This can lead to a noticeable reduction in energy costs and a lower carbon footprint.

2. Low Maintenance
Unlike wooden doors and windows that need routine sanding, painting, or polishing, uPVC requires very little upkeep. It does not warp, rot, or corrode when exposed to moisture or extreme climate condition. A basic clean with a wet cloth is all it requires to keep uPVC frames looking fresh and tidy for years.

3. Toughness
uPVC is exceptionally strong and can endure long-lasting exposure to extreme aspects without losing its structural stability. Its resistance to rust, rot, and UV rays guarantees that your doors and windows maintain their appearance and functionality in time.

4. Improved Security
Security is a leading priority for any home, and uPVC doors and windows deliver on this front. They are crafted with multi-point locking systems and reinforced frames, making them robust and difficult to tamper with. This includes an additional layer of security to your residential or commercial property.

5. Weather Resistance
Whether you live in a location susceptible to heavy rains, scorching heat, or freezing temperature levels, uPVC windows and doors can withstand it all. Their weather condition resistance avoids water leakage, fading, and thermal expansion, ensuring they remain untouched by altering environment conditions.

6. Noise Reduction


If you reside in a bustling city or near a hectic roadway, sound pollution can be a major concern. uPVC windows and doors offer significant soundproofing, specifically when coupled with double-glazed glass. This assists create a relaxing indoor environment, allowing you to delight in a tranquil home.

7. Visual Appeal
Offered in a wide variety of colors, designs, and surfaces, uPVC doors and windows offer flexibility in style to suit any architectural appearance. Whether you prefer a crisp white finish, a timber-like look, or something more contemporary and sleek, uPVC frames can be customized to match your home's aesthetic.

8. Eco-Friendly Solution
uPVC is a recyclable material, making it a sustainable choice for environmentally-conscious homeowners. By selecting uPVC, you're adding to reduced waste and supporting a greener world. Additionally, their energy performance even more supports environment-friendly living.

uPVC vs.  upvc doors and windows
While traditional wood and aluminum doors and windows have their own charm, uPVC often outshines them in regards to sturdiness, affordability, and usefulness. Wood, for example, is prone to termites, wetness damage, and needs routine maintenance. Aluminum, although strong, can carry out heat easily, which might compromise energy effectiveness. uPVC combines the best of both worlds by being resilient, cost-effective, and energy-efficient.
